The film, set in the 1970s, follows a working-class romantic who is framed by a ruthless gangster after falling for his girlfriend. After years in prison, the protagonist returns with a singular mission: to exact revenge. Ritchson, known for his roles in Reacher and War Machine, delivers a performance that relies heavily on physicality, as the film eschews dialogue in favor of visceral action sequences. Directed by Potsy Ponciroli, the film draws on the director’s experience with action-driven storytelling, particularly his acclaimed western Old Henry. The screenplay, written by Chad St. John, features a star-studded cast including Shailene Woodley, Ben Foster, Pablo Schreiber, Ben McKenzie, Zoë Kravitz, and Natasha McElhone. The film’s soundtrack, composed by Grammy-winning Detroit musician Jack White, further enhances its retro aesthetic. While Motor City has found success on streaming platforms, its critical reception has been mixed. The film holds a 63% rating on Rotten Tomatoes and a 65% score on Popcornmeter, reflecting divided opinions among audiences and critics.
